Financials
Income statement
Fiscal date | 2024 | 2023 | 2022 | 2021 |
---|---|---|---|---|
Total reported revenue | 3.6B | 3.7B | 2.9B | 2.0B |
Cost of revenue | 1.4B | 1.5B | 1.3B | 919.3M |
Gross profit | 2.2B | 2.2B | 1.6B | 1.1B |
Operating expense | ||||
Research & development | — | — | — | — |
Selling general and admin | 1.5B | 1.5B | 1.2B | 987.9M |
Other operating expenses | 8.3M | 3.8M | 300K | — |
Operating income | 624.1M | 659.7M | 419.9M | 113.6M |
Non operating interest income | ||||
Income | 13.6M | 14.3M | 8.8M | 3.6M |
Expense | 130.5M | 129.5M | 109.5M | 121.2M |
Other income expense | — | — | — | — |
Pretax income | 490.8M | 584.9M | 362.6M | -32.7M |
Tax provision | 118.3M | 134.6M | 24.3M | -56.2M |
Net income | 372.6M | 450.3M | 338.3M | 23.5M |
Basic EPS | — | 0.3 | 0.2 | 0.0 |
Diluted EPS | — | 0.3 | 0.2 | 0.0 |
Basic average shares | — | 1.6B | 1.5B | 1.5B |
Diluted average shares | — | 1.6B | 1.5B | 1.5B |
EBITDA | 837.3M | 844.5M | 593.3M | 308.3M |
Net income from continuing op. | 372.6M | 450.3M | 338.3M | 23.5M |
Minority interests | -26.9M | -33.3M | -25.6M | -9.2M |
Preferred stock dividends | 0 | 0 | 0 | 0 |